New York, NY – October 14, 2025 — The world of Avatar: The Last Airbender and The Legend of Korra is poised for its most explosive video game adaptation yet. Publisher Gameplay Group International has officially announced Avatar Legends: The Fighting Game (working title), a 1v1 competitive fighting title that promises to bring the franchise’s iconic elemental bending to the forefront of the fighting game community. The reveal, which took place during a highly anticipated reunion panel at New York Comic Con 2025, has sent a shockwave of excitement across the global gaming market and the devoted Avatar fanbase.

A Deep Dive into the Elemental Combat System
The core of the Avatar universe is the mastery of the four elements: Water, Earth, Fire, and Air. Avatar Legends: The Fighting Game is designed to encapsulate this mastery through a proprietary system that differentiates it from traditional fighters. Gameplay Group International is introducing the “Flow System,” a mechanic centered on movement and elemental stance-switching, which is crucial for maximizing combo potential and managing stage positioning. This innovation suggests a high-skill ceiling, rewarding players who truly understand the dynamic nature of bending.
Key Gameplay Features Confirmed:
- Hand-Drawn 2D Animation: The visual style is a direct, loving tribute to the original animated series, ensuring character expressions and elemental effects are vibrant and authentic.
- 12 Playable Characters at Launch: The initial roster includes fan-favorite Benders like Aang, Korra, Zuko, Katara, Toph, and Azula, alongside non-bender Sokka. More characters from the sprawling Avatarverse are promised via a seasonal content model.
- Support Characters: Players can select a support character—such as Appa or Naga—to influence their fighting style and grant special, tactical moves during a match.
- Proprietary Rollback Netcode and Cross-Play: Recognizing the demands of modern online gaming, the developers are prioritizing best-in-class netcode and full cross-platform play, aiming for a smooth, lag-free competitive experience. Single-Player Campaign and Narrative Value
Beyond the high-octane PvP combat, the game will feature a comprehensive single-player campaign with an original narrative. While details remain vague as the game is in pre-alpha development, the commitment to a new story is a significant draw, promising to explore previously unseen corners of the Avatar world. In addition to the campaign, players can look forward to Combo Trials to hone their skills and a Gallery Mode to appreciate the stunning 2D art assets. These features underline the commitment to both competitive depth and fan service.
Release Timeline and Platform Availability
Avatar Legends: The Fighting Game is targeting a Summer 2026 launch window. This timing positions it strategically in a potentially busy year for the franchise, which is also expecting the animated feature film The Legend of Aang: The Last Airbender to hit theaters later that year.
The game will launch on:
- PlayStation 5 (PS5)
- PlayStation 4 (PS4)
- Xbox Series X|S
- Nintendo Switch 2 (Confirmed for the next-generation Nintendo console)
- PC (via Steam)
